暗号資産(仮想通貨)のブロックチェーン技術を学ぶ冊の本
はじめに
暗号資産(仮想通貨)は、近年、金融業界だけでなく、社会全体に大きな影響を与えています。その根幹をなす技術がブロックチェーンであり、その仕組みを理解することは、現代社会を理解する上で不可欠と言えるでしょう。本書は、ブロックチェーン技術の基礎から応用までを網羅し、暗号資産の仕組みを深く理解するためのガイドブックとして執筆されました。専門的な知識がなくても理解できるよう、平易な言葉で解説し、図解を多用することで、視覚的にも理解を深められるように工夫しました。
第1章 ブロックチェーン技術の基礎
1.1 分散型台帳技術とは
ブロックチェーンは、分散型台帳技術(Distributed Ledger Technology: DLT)の一種です。従来の集中型台帳システムとは異なり、複数の参加者によって共有され、管理される台帳です。これにより、単一の障害点(Single Point of Failure)を排除し、データの改ざんを困難にしています。各参加者は台帳のコピーを保持し、新しい取引が発生するたびに、その情報をネットワーク全体に共有します。共有された情報は、ネットワーク参加者の合意によって検証され、台帳に追加されます。
1.2 ブロックとチェーンの構造
ブロックチェーンは、その名の通り、ブロックと呼ばれるデータの塊が鎖のように連なって構成されています。各ブロックには、取引データ、タイムスタンプ、そして前のブロックのハッシュ値が含まれています。ハッシュ値は、ブロックの内容を要約したものであり、内容が少しでも変更されるとハッシュ値も変化します。このハッシュ値を利用することで、ブロック間の整合性を検証し、データの改ざんを検知することができます。ブロックがチェーンに追加されると、そのブロックは過去のブロックと不可分に結びつき、改ざんが極めて困難になります。
1.3 暗号技術の役割
ブロックチェーンのセキュリティを支える重要な要素が暗号技術です。特に、公開鍵暗号方式とハッシュ関数が重要な役割を果たします。公開鍵暗号方式は、暗号化と復号化に異なる鍵を使用することで、安全な通信を実現します。ハッシュ関数は、入力データから固定長のハッシュ値を生成する関数であり、データの改ざん検知に利用されます。これらの暗号技術を組み合わせることで、ブロックチェーンは高いセキュリティを確保しています。
1.4 コンセンサスアルゴリズム
分散型台帳システムにおいて、データの整合性を保つためには、ネットワーク参加者間の合意形成が不可欠です。この合意形成の仕組みをコンセンサスアルゴリズムと呼びます。代表的なコンセンサスアルゴリズムには、Proof of Work (PoW)、Proof of Stake (PoS) などがあります。PoWは、計算問題を解くことで合意形成を行う方式であり、Bitcoinなどで採用されています。PoSは、暗号資産の保有量に応じて合意形成に参加する権利を与える方式であり、Ethereumなどで採用されています。
第2章 暗号資産(仮想通貨)の仕組み
2.1 Bitcoinの仕組み
Bitcoinは、世界で最初に誕生した暗号資産であり、ブロックチェーン技術の実用的な応用例として広く知られています。Bitcoinのブロックチェーンは、PoWを採用しており、マイナーと呼ばれる参加者が計算問題を解くことで新しいブロックを生成し、取引を検証します。Bitcoinの取引は、公開鍵と秘密鍵を用いてデジタル署名され、その署名によって取引の正当性が確認されます。Bitcoinの供給量は2100万枚に制限されており、その希少性が価値を支えています。
2.2 Ethereumの仕組み
Ethereumは、Bitcoinに次いで時価総額の大きい暗号資産であり、スマートコントラクトと呼ばれるプログラムを実行できるプラットフォームを提供しています。Ethereumのブロックチェーンは、PoSへの移行を進めており、エネルギー消費量の削減を目指しています。スマートコントラクトは、特定の条件が満たされた場合に自動的に実行されるプログラムであり、金融、サプライチェーン、投票など、様々な分野での応用が期待されています。
2.3 その他の暗号資産
BitcoinとEthereum以外にも、数多くの暗号資産が存在します。それぞれ異なる特徴や目的を持っており、特定の分野に特化した暗号資産も存在します。例えば、Rippleは、国際送金を迅速かつ低コストで行うための暗号資産であり、Litecoinは、Bitcoinよりも高速な取引処理を可能にする暗号資産です。これらの暗号資産は、それぞれ独自のブロックチェーン技術を採用しており、その仕組みも異なります。
第3章 ブロックチェーン技術の応用
3.1 金融分野への応用
ブロックチェーン技術は、金融分野において、決済、送金、証券取引、融資など、様々な応用が期待されています。ブロックチェーンを利用することで、取引の透明性を高め、コストを削減し、セキュリティを向上させることができます。例えば、国際送金においては、ブロックチェーンを利用することで、仲介業者を介さずに直接送金を行うことができ、手数料を大幅に削減することができます。
3.2 サプライチェーン管理への応用
ブロックチェーン技術は、サプライチェーン管理においても、製品の追跡、品質管理、偽造防止など、様々な応用が期待されています。ブロックチェーンを利用することで、製品の製造から販売までの過程を記録し、その情報を共有することができます。これにより、製品のトレーサビリティを向上させ、偽造品を排除することができます。
3.3 医療分野への応用
ブロックチェーン技術は、医療分野においても、患者の医療情報の管理、医薬品の追跡、臨床試験のデータ管理など、様々な応用が期待されています。ブロックチェーンを利用することで、患者の医療情報を安全に管理し、医療機関間の情報共有を促進することができます。また、医薬品の追跡においては、偽造医薬品の流通を防止することができます。
3.4 その他の応用
ブロックチェーン技術は、上記以外にも、投票システム、著作権管理、不動産取引など、様々な分野での応用が期待されています。ブロックチェーンの分散型で透明性の高い特性は、様々な社会問題を解決するための有効な手段となり得ます。
第4章 ブロックチェーン技術の課題と展望
4.1 スケーラビリティ問題
ブロックチェーン技術の普及を阻む大きな課題の一つが、スケーラビリティ問題です。ブロックチェーンの取引処理能力は、従来の集中型システムに比べて低いことが多く、取引量が増加すると処理速度が低下し、手数料が高騰する可能性があります。この問題を解決するために、様々な技術的なアプローチが研究されています。例えば、シャーディング、レイヤー2ソリューションなどが挙げられます。
4.2 セキュリティ問題
ブロックチェーン技術は、高いセキュリティを誇るとされていますが、完全に安全であるわけではありません。スマートコントラクトの脆弱性、51%攻撃、秘密鍵の紛失など、様々なセキュリティリスクが存在します。これらのリスクを軽減するために、セキュリティ対策の強化が不可欠です。
4.3 法規制の整備
暗号資産やブロックチェーン技術に関する法規制は、まだ整備途上にあります。法規制の不確実性は、暗号資産市場の発展を阻害する要因となり得ます。各国政府は、暗号資産やブロックチェーン技術に関する法規制を整備し、健全な市場環境を構築する必要があります。
4.4 ブロックチェーン技術の展望
ブロックチェーン技術は、今後も様々な分野で応用が拡大していくことが予想されます。特に、Web3と呼ばれる分散型インターネットの実現に向けて、ブロックチェーン技術は重要な役割を果たすと考えられています。Web3は、ユーザーが自身のデータを管理し、中央集権的なプラットフォームに依存しないインターネットの姿を目指しています。
まとめ
本書では、ブロックチェーン技術の基礎から応用までを網羅し、暗号資産の仕組みを深く理解するためのガイドブックとして解説しました。ブロックチェーン技術は、金融、サプライチェーン、医療など、様々な分野で革新をもたらす可能性を秘めています。しかし、スケーラビリティ問題、セキュリティ問題、法規制の整備など、解決すべき課題も多く存在します。これらの課題を克服し、ブロックチェーン技術の可能性を最大限に引き出すためには、技術開発、法規制の整備、そして社会全体の理解が不可欠です。本書が、ブロックチェーン技術の理解を深め、その未来を創造するための一助となれば幸いです。